Cultural Expectations: Comparing Quiet Norms on Public Transport in Turkey and ‍Ireland

The contrast in public transport etiquette between turkey and Ireland highlights profound cultural differences. In Turkey,⁤ the⁣ muted​ atmosphere on buses and trams⁢ is almost palpable. Passengers are expected to maintain a low profile, often resorting to whispers or complete silence during their journeys. This tacit expectation stems from a cultural value placed on ‌respect and tranquility in shared spaces, deemed essential for communal harmony.Observers ⁤frequently enough note how entire ⁢compartments can feel⁢ like serene‍ islands, where even ⁢the flick of ⁤a phone screen is minimized to avoid disruption.‌ The notion is not simply about noise; it’s reminiscent ​of a broader⁤ social contract where individuals honor the shared experience through silence.

in stark contrast, the Irish approach to public transport is characterized by a vibrant noise‌ level that can be ⁤shocking to those from⁢ quieter cultures.Soundscapes filled with conversations,​ laughter, and even music are commonplace, contributing to a lively atmosphere‌ that reflects Ireland’s sociable ⁢nature.The expectation here leans toward community interaction, with people frequently enough⁣ feeling permitted—if not encouraged—to ⁢engage openly, regardless of the time of day. this openness fosters connections among riders, creating a sense of friendliness that can sometimes overwhelm newcomers. For many, the raucous energy of an‌ Irish bus⁢ or train ride symbolizes​ the heart of communal life, where every journey becomes​ an chance for engagement rather than a period of enforced silence.

Aspect turkey Ireland
Volume⁢ Level Low, respectful High, engaging
Social Interactions Minimal Frequent
Cultural Value Tranquility Community

Recommendations for Navigating Cross-Cultural Public Transport Experiences

When navigating public transport in different cultures, it’s essential to be aware⁤ of the distinct social norms that govern passenger behavior.as ⁢an example,in Turkey,the expectation of silence ‌ on ⁢public ‍transport reflects ‌a cultural respect for personal space and tranquility.Passengers are ⁢typically reserved, with conversations kept ⁢to‍ a minimum, ⁣and loud⁤ interactions frequently enough frowned upon. In contrast, in Ireland, public transport is frequently enough characterized by a more lively atmosphere, where‍ chatting and laughter among passengers​ are commonplace.⁣ Understanding these differences can alleviate⁤ the discomfort of⁢ cross-cultural ‌exchanges ‌and foster more respectful ⁢travel experiences.

To⁤ help travelers adapt and enjoy⁤ their public transport journeys⁤ across ⁤cultures,consider the following tips:

  • Observe ⁢Your Surroundings: pay attention to ⁣how locals behave,adjusting your​ conduct⁢ accordingly.
  • engage politely: If conversations are⁣ common,feel free ⁣to initiate pleasant chat,especially in more sociable environments.
  • Mind Your Volume: keep your voice at ⁤a reasonable⁤ level to ensure you don’t disrupt others, particularly ⁤in quieter cultures.
  • Be Respectful: ‌Always show consideration for personal space and communal comfort, which can vary​ greatly from one culture to the next.
